The State agrees that it shall: <br />1. Make available to the Contractor for the purpose of <br />this contract not to exceed the sum of Four Hundred Sixty -Five <br />Thousand .Dollars ($465,000). Said Four Hundred Sixty -Five <br />Thousand Dollars ($465,000) shall he made available to the <br />Contractor in accordance with the following terms and <br />conditions: <br />a. Beginning with the monthly period commencing <br />August 15, 1981, and for every month thereafter until <br />said project has been completed, the Contactor shall <br />prepare with the assistance of the consulting <br />engineer referred to in paragraph A.1. above an <br />estimate of the funds required from the State for <br />project construction during that month and shall <br />forward said estimate to the State not less than <br />fifteen (15) days prior to the beginning of such <br />month. <br />b. Upon receipt and approval by the State of such <br />monthly estimate, the State will, within forty (40) <br />days from the receipt of such estimate, pay over to <br />the Contractor the amount: of Lhe monthly estimate or <br />�- h �� prov,� -d by 1 -he. <br />suc;ii Portia +� .her�af �s h�s� �e^ Y' <br />State. <br />C. No payments will he made under this contract <br />until the project plans and specifications referred <br />to in paragraph A.1. above are approved by the State. <br />2.
